Reset Button: The reset button is used to load the factory default
settings. Use a pointed object to hold the reset button down for five
seconds to load the factory defaults.
Name
Color
Function
End Panel LED Indicators
Ethernet
Orange
10 Mbps Ethernet connection.
Green
100 Mbps Ethernet connection.
Off
Ethernet cable is disconnected.
Top Panel LED Indicators
Ready
Red
Steady on:
Power is on, and the NPort is booting
up.
Blinking: An IP conflict exists or the DHCP server
did not respond properly.
Green
Steady on:
The NPort is functioning normally.
Blinking:
The NPort is responding to Locate
function.
Off
Power is off or a power error condition exists.
WLAN
Green
Steady on:
Wireless enabled.
Blinking:
The NPort can’t establish a WLAN
connection with the AP (Infrastructure).
Off
Wireless not enabled.
Serial 1
Serial 2
Orange
The serial port is receiving data.
Green
The serial port is transmitting data.
Off
No data is flowing to or from the serial port.
